- SimDag provides some functionnalities to simulate parallel task scheduling
- with DAGs models (Direct Acyclic Graphs).
- The old versions of SimGrid were based on DAGs. But the DAG part (named SG)
- was removed in SimGrid 3 because the new kernel (\ref SURF_API) was implemented. \ref SURF_API
- was much faster and more flexible than SG and did not use DAGs.
- SimDag is a new implementation of DAGs handling and it is built on top of \ref SURF_API.

- \section SD_who Who should use this (and who shouldn't)
-
- You should use this programming environment of the SimGrid suite if you want
- to study algorithms and heuristics with DAGs of parallel tasks.
- If you don't need to use DAGs for your simulation, have a look at the
- \ref MSG_API programming environment.
- If you want to study an existing MPI program, have a look at the
- \ref SMPI_API one.
- If none of those programming environments fits your needs, you may
- consider implementing your own directly on top of \ref SURF_API (but you
- probably want to contact us before).
